The meaning of Olympic

People have start to forget the other meaning behind the Olympic games.

This have to track back to a few thousands years ago start from the ancient Greece. There are many separated countries such as Athens, Sparta, Olympia and many more unlike the united Greece today. Wars between these country are often. The Olympic event was first started in the sanctuary for the Greeks' mighty gods and goddesses in Olympia. Then the event grew larger and it became a competition between the countries. Each of the country will send out their best athletes to compete with other country in the games.

At ancients, the game was held in every 4 year. During the Olympic year, truce among all countries are announce. If war is ongoing, soldiers have to lay down their weapons during that year no matter what. This is to make sure all the participants and audiences of the games to have a safe journey to the mount Olympus.

How they scam you through phone

This is my very own experience. They've grown smarter. They try to con you by making story over a period of time. I'll break down in details as below:

1. They called me on 12 July and told me their company will be holding an lucky draw event on 15 July. It'll be shown as live telecast in Macau. I'm one of the lucky contestant they pick for foreigner. They talk so fast until I don even hear what channel showing live telecast, what is the event name and the company name. What I can hear loud and clear is my lucky numbers and the lucky draw date. They want me to attend the event. I'm not rich, not free and not mad enough to attend. So I rejected them. (Only the rich, the free and the mad one will attend their event in Macau) I wan't to ask them how they get my numbers but they talk so fast and so blurred via the phone and ask me to remember my lucky number, thats it.

2. After a few days, where I've forgotten about this issue, they called again on 16 July. They asked whether I watched the show? I told where the hack I have their Macau channel! They said nevermind as I've won their 3rd prize in the lucky draw! Then they start their skillful talk again which you can't really hear what the F* they said clearly. I just roughly heard I won a car. However I'm a foreigner, the car is useless to me. So the hotel is willing to convert to cash for me worth how much I can't hear. They tell me to go down and collect my own. I just tell them impossible. Then they continue to said that they need my address so that they can sent me a letter . So I told them my company address. I started to question them about their event name and Hotel names. They told me in Chinese and I insist the name in English. What I found is - "Seaview Nations in Macau spend a holiday center" An event name sounds weird right? So I tried to look up this in the Internet and I found nothing.

3. After this issue has been cooled down and I nearly forget about it, they called again on the 29 July. Asking me whether I received their cheque or not. Sincerely, I told them no. Them they said they'll cheque again as they issue the cheque via a lawyer firm. They'll find out and send the cheque to me in 3-4 days time. Then the left me a contact name - 许志豪 (which I think is fake) and a Macau contact number - +85362296401.

4. Really thought this should be over by now. Who knows, they called me on 5 August. They are very polite though. They ask me did I received any letter from them. With polite, I replied no to them. Seems shocked, they ask me to call to their "lawyer" which they entrusted the letter to by giving me another Macau phone number - +85366165384.

5. The fun begins when I called to the lawyer firm. A person answering my call said he's from a lawyer firm!!! I told them my situation and they proceed to check all the info for me. After a few minutes, a lawyer called back. He said I've won HKD 420k in total. The Macau government need a 3.5% tax on every draw prize and he calculated and converted for me into SGD. Roughly SGD2600 taxed and Prize won is SGD70k. Then he said my amount to sent over by cheque was too big, the Macau government only allow HKD120k transaction, higher then that need to go to Macau and settle it our own. Then I scold him why he din't mail or letter to me! He try to back his ass by Bullsh*tting his Macau laws again... He adviced me to arrange a meeting with him by coming down to Macau myself. Before we end the conversation, I insist him giving me his Firm's name in English and what he gave me is just www.cfunion.com and ask me to check myself cause he's very busy. (www.cfunion.com is invalid)

6. So I called back to the hotel telling him the lawyer is useless. Then, they said they can arrange the meeting for me if I come down. So, this time I answered I'm coming down myself. Please arranged for me your hotel room! They seem shock and he'll seek advice from his manager and call me back in a moment. They ask me to call the lawyer for making appointment too. Then, I called the lawyer by telling him I'm going down on this friday!

7. After a while, they called back mentioning the prize withdrawing date dues today!!! They told me the manager already give 3 weeks allowance to collect. My temper rose and scold them its thier useless lawyer and how can I go down to Macau today! There's no more flight to Macau today and how can I make it where it's already late noon. I sounds angry and frustrated as if I'm going to lose the prize! Then, they kept appologized to me and they said they'll tried their best to help me in order to get the prize money.

8. Later, they phoned me again. They told me there's another similar case where the winner can't go collect himself. Gave me a Malaysian number - +60172408773 and ask me to seek advise from him. I called, he told me he is limb so he transfer the tax money to the Macau government and then after 90 minutes, the lawyer transferred back the full amount of prize money back to his bank account. 9. After that, I called the lawyer again. sound nervously as if I'm going to lose all my prize money if I can't settle today, telling him my awful situation and beg for his help to come out the SGD2600 for me and I'll pay back to him later. He dig out all the Macau Laws again and continue to Bullsh*t for a period of time where I really don't know what the F* is he talking as if he really scared that I can listen clearly to what he said. Until the end of the chat, he slowed down. He said: If the hotel willing to issue a letter to let him proceed with the transaction + after I bank in the money to the Macau government, only he can transfer the prize money to me.

10. After that, they called me again. They said they can issue the letter if I'm able to bank in the money to the government and they willing to give me the government account number if I have the tax money. (How come they know the government account?!?) I told them I do not have SGD2600 as I'm very poor kid just started to work. Surprisingly, they ask me how much I have and they taught me how to borrow money from friends and relatives by not telling them I won SGD70k?!?! Then, they even try to brainwash me by telling me how this SGD70k can help me! Them, they gave me 30 minutes to gather money and they'll contact me before 4pm as the lawyer firm closed at 5pm.

11. from 2-4pm, every 30 minutes, they called me. Seems very concerned on my progress of gathering the money. They even told me they really want me to get the prize money, so that they can promote their hotel! At 4pm, the grand moment, I just answered them I don't want the money, I can't get SGD2600. So, they just said sorry and hung up the phone.......

What a realistic world. Really no money no talk. My fellow friends, please becareful and try not to be conned by this "lucky draw contest" specially they knocked on your door or phone to you.
